The captian of the cruise ship that collided with rocks and high sided in Italy announced in court that he made a mistake when the accident happened. In a tapped phone conversation he said to a friend that it was not an accident however, and that he was pressured by officials to steer the boat into the area of the collision. The captain has faced a lot of scrutiny for his behavior regaurding what happened on that day. He faces charges of manslaughter, abandoning ship, and shipwreck. He has faced the most judgement by other captains for abandoning his own ship when it struck the rocks and rolled onto its side. It was also found that he was going 15 knots at the time in which he hit the rocks, which some people think was well too fast for the dangerous area that he was going into.The captain is in serious trouble for the endangerment of 4,000 that he caused by his careless operation of the ship he was piloting.

Braun to Accept MVP Despite Steroid Scandal
In a recent interview, Ryan Braun announced that he is still planning on accepting his MLB MVP award despite his pending 50 game suspension for testing positive for high levels of synthetic testosterone. When his agent was questioned on whether or not Braun would appear or accept the award the agent responded with "he will be there to accept the award." As a part of the award ceremony Braun is scheduled to give an acceptance speech for obtaining this award. This speech may be an opportunity for Braun to voice his opinion about the accusations, as he has been known to be very clear on his opinion of the suspension stating that it was "B.S." in an interview with ESPN. Even though the league has decided not to strip him of his title,this weekend's ceremonies should be interesting for fans of Ryan Braun.
